## Who to ping about GiftNote

Welcome aboard! GiftNote is our donation-receipt mailer for the Larchfield Fund. Template tweaks go to the comms folks; delivery failures and bounce weirdness go to the platform crew. Don't push template changes on Fridays — receipts batch over the weekend. For anything GiftNote-related, start with the address below.

billing contact of kaweg-tajeg = drudor.lamion.oliath@torvalabs.test

**Ticket QX-4417: Autocomplete index crawling again**

Hey on-call — the Fennel search box is taking 3-4 seconds to suggest anything, and support is getting pinged. Pretty sure the prefix index on Shardwell node 3 didn't finish its nightly rebuild, so queries are falling back to full scans. Can you check the rebuild job and kick it if it stalled? The failing run is tagged with this trace token below.

build token for yajof-bajof: htk31_506ff1188f74596b5bb2eec94edc43c

## Changelog — Parityscope v3.8.1

Rotated the release signing key for the Parityscope hotel rate-parity checker. The previous key reached its scheduled expiry; no compromise is suspected. All artifacts from v3.8.1 onward are signed with the new key, and older releases remain valid under the retired one until the archive sweep in Q3. Future maintainers: update the verification config in deploy/trust.yaml and rebuild the checker image before publishing. Rotation steps are documented in the maintenance runbook. The new signing key follows.

rollout seal: bky4_x7Gc